Effects of fermented mulberry feed on the growth performance,nutritional components,and immune function of fattening pigs
To clarify the influences of fermented mulberry feed to the growth performance,nutritional composition,and immune function of fattening pigs,a hybrid fattening pig with an average weight of(60±3.59)kg was selected.Five treatments were set up with 3 replicates per group and 6 pigs per replicate,and the addition amounts of fermented mulberry powder in each treatment were 0,4%,8%,12%,and 16%,respectively.A 50 day breeding experiment was conducted.The results showed that when the addition amount of fermented feed mulberry was 12% or less,there was no significant difference in the final weight,average daily feed intake,average daily weight gain,and feed to meat ratio of fattening pigs compared to the control group(P>0.05).Different levels of fermented feed mulberry had no significant effect on the water content,crude protein content,and intramuscular fat content of fattening pig pork(P>0.05),although the crude protein content slightly increased and intramuscular fat content slightly decreased with the increase of fermented feed mulberry added.Adding 12% fermented feed mulberry can significantly reduce the proportion of saturated fatty acids in pork and significantly increase the proportion of unsaturated fatty acids in pork(P<0.05).The proportion of polyunsaturated fatty acids in pork was not significantly affected by different levels of fermented feed mulberry(P>0.05).Adding 12% fermented feed mulberry can significantly reduce the levels of serum IgG,IgM and IgA(P<0.05).Different amounts of fermented feed mulberry had no significant effect on the serum immune cytokine levels of fattening pigs(P>0.05).This study indicates that adding 12% fermented feed mulberry to the basic feed has no significant negative effects on the average daily feed intake,average daily weight gain,and feed to meat ratio of fattening pigs.It can improve the quality of pork to a certain extent,significantly increase the level of immunoglobulin in the serum of fattening pigs,and enhance immune function.
